Entertaining

This was a cute and funny read. Komachi is my favorite, and the epitome of cuteness overload. There are quite a few plots that seem to be zeroing on Sam as a target. It is never good when deities find you amusing and want to play. The last part was absolutely frustrating. Like, this whole battle and then bam who are you? Not fair.

Excellent Beginning

Story spends a bit too much time on stats (for me) and doesn’t always fully explain some backstory, but despite that is well written and has a unique setting that will have me reading book 2.
